#22c70e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#22c70e is composed of 13.3% red, 78%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 93%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 113.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 41.8%. #22c70e color hex could be obtained by blending #44ff1c with #008f00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#22c70e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#22c70e has RGB values of R:34, G:199,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2279182.

Shades and Tints of #22c70e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031001 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#22c70e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696d68 is the less saturated color, while #1ccf06 is the most saturated one.
